Sheep Mountain may have raptor closure issues. Please contact RMNP for further details.
Description
This is the wide crack / chimney to the left of the hueco'ed line on the north face of the crack. It needs a serious brushing to be worth the effort. It's probably better to climb up and down the east face; however, it may the most expedient way back up to fetch your gear and thread the anchor.
